Subject: Handover — hermetic build migration

Hi team, handing this over before I'm out. We're moving the Quarrystone build onto the new hermetic system, which means the build no longer reads ambient env vars — everything comes from the manifest. Support will mostly see failures where old scripts assumed a live DB during compile; those need stubbing. If you genuinely need to verify schema state during a build, use the sandbox replica via the connection string below.

primary connection of tawif-yajeg = postgresql://rusiel_svc:G879q9cx6GsSvj@db-dd9f.norvagrid.internal:5432/casath

### Runbook: FixtureForge seed failures

If FixtureForge refuses to generate seeded test data, the usual cause is a missing signing secret in the worker's env file. Restart after editing; hot reload doesn't pick it up. Open the env file and insert the secret line directly after this sentence.

vault entry, kafog-yahop: COURIER_KEY8=0faa53ae

Title: Intermittent connection failures on StallSense occupancy feed

The Garage Deck 4 occupancy feed has been dropping every 10–15 minutes since last night's network maintenance. Retries succeed but the gap corrupts rollups. Restarting the ingest pod did not help. To reproduce and inspect the backlog table, connect with the string below.

replica DSN, kajep-yahag: mssql://praok_svc:iF@db-8d68.plorvaio.local:5432/eliion

Ticket: Drift detected in the Ashgrove retention sweeper. Several prod shards are honoring an older purge-window and batch-size than what shipped in release 4.2, so plugin hooks registered against the new deletion lifecycle never fire on those shards. Plugin authors: if your onPurge callbacks seem silent, this is why — not a bug in your code. We are reconciling shards this week; no plugin-side changes needed. To help you validate against the intended behavior, the canonical production configuration is shown below.

deployment values, kajep-kageg:
[praix]
host = praix.paliqcorp.corp
user = praix_svc
database = praix_prod